This is an off topic about when you guys transplant seedlings outside. I'm in zone 7 so anyone in my zone or near me that gardens, please tell me when you guys typically plant your veggies and flowers. Thanks :) |

Certainly depends on the plant. You want to check online for your "last frost date". For me (zone 6) it's may 15th. Some seeds are direct sow, some should be started indoors and then transplanted after your frost date. Potatoes are super early ( mid April) pumpkins are pretty late. (Mid June) good luck! |

Mathew: I wait until the weather is not too cold (after your last frost). I live in So Cal so it's never very cold at all anyway. But I just ease my little seedlings from inside my house into a small greenhouse I have outside to let them mature. It's a personal call because your zone and the type of plant does make a difference. My method is just to slowly introduce them to the outside world. |
